WebMay 5, 2014 · A new monitor and filter product from Israel’s BioFishency will provide an affordable “black box” to fish farmers so they can grow healthier fish using less water — without replacing the whole farm. The box works for both freshwater and saltwater fish. An added benefit of BioFishency’s product, now in development at the Trendlines ...
